**Key ceremony checklist — item 7: Event schema registry (Ledgerpine)**

Verify the registry's signing key rotated cleanly. All event schemas published after rotation must validate against the new key; spot-check three recent topics. Old-key schemas stay readable but reject new writes. Confirm the Ashgrove replica picked up the rotation before proceeding. If the registry refuses the new key, unlock recovery mode with the passphrase below.

recovery phrase for bawep-kawef: oliath-casdor

### Step 4: Publish the shared component library

After CI passes on the Hollen component library, bump the minor version in the manifest — never the patch, since downstream apps pin to minor. Tag the release, then run the publish job from the deploy console. The job signs the package before pushing it to the internal registry, so verification must succeed before anything ships. The publish job expects the signing key that follows.

signing key of bagap-yawep = bky13_TbfT6ZMUoGJo2

## Landlord Site Audit — What Contractors Need to Know

Greywick Estates is auditing Pelham Yard next week, so expect extra foot traffic. Contractors should keep walkways clear and tools tagged. The loading bay stays open till 16:00 only. You'll still badge in as normal at the side gate — just use the contractor code below.

turnstile pass: bdg-JVSWH-52711